

Doris was born in Seattle to Hattie and Arthur Hogle, residing in Mt. Baker, Hillman and finally Beacon Hill for most of her adult life. After graduating from Franklin HS in 1942, she went to work for Pacific Bell in downtown Seattle for the next 10 years. Those years during WWII were very memorable to her in the many lifelong friends she made. Doris and Edwin married June 19, 1953. She joyfully embraced the births of her two daughters and the many years of homemaking that followed, especially sharing her talents of baking, sewing and gardening with family and friends. They were members of Beacon Hill Presbyterian Church which was a source of close supportive friendships. Her joy was enhanced with the births of each of her grandchildren, and to her last day she was genuinely interested in their lives. Doris was predeceased by Edwin, her husband of 35 years. She is survived by her daughters Marilyn (Nick) Papini and Marsha McCrum; granddaughters Laura (Matt) Shumate and Danielle (Jason) Werschkul; grandson Kyle Heckenlaible and numerous other beloved family. Doris left with her loved ones the belief that she lived by: “Always be happy whatever your lot in life is. Always remember to be honest, persevere and show kindness to others.”
